Consulting

Enhancing Compliance with Advanced Rule Management

Enhancing Compliance with Advanced Rule Management

Introduction to Rule Management In today’s rapidly evolving regulatory landscape, businesses must stay compliant with various legal and industry standards. Effective rule management is crucial for ensuring that compliance processes are streamlined and efficient. Understanding Rule Management Rule management involves defining, monitoring, and updating the regulations and guidelines that govern […]

Enhancing Compliance with Advanced Rule Management Read More »

Enhancing Rule Management for Optimal Compliance

Enhancing Rule Management for Optimal Compliance

Introduction to Rule Management At Resolute IT Consulting, we understand that effective rule management is crucial for maintaining compliance and operational efficiency. By implementing robust rule management systems, businesses can ensure that their processes align with regulatory requirements and internal policies. Why Rule Management Matters Rule management helps organizations automate

Enhancing Rule Management for Optimal Compliance Read More »

Enhancing Rule Management with Microservices: Best Practices for Modern Software Architectures

Enhancing Rule Management with Microservices: Best Practices for Modern Software Architectures

In today’s rapidly evolving technology landscape, effective rule management is crucial for maintaining robust and adaptable software systems. At Resolute IT Consulting, we specialize in leveraging microservices to enhance rule management, ensuring that our clients’ systems are both scalable and resilient. ## The Power of Microservices in Rule Management Microservices

Enhancing Rule Management with Microservices: Best Practices for Modern Software Architectures Read More »

Enhancing Performance with Microservices: Best Practices

Enhancing Performance with Microservices: Best Practices

Introduction

At Resolute IT Consulting, we understand the importance of performance and scalability in modern software applications. One of the key architectural patterns that can help achieve these goals is microservices. In this post, we’ll delve into best practices for enhancing performance with microservices.

What Are Microservices?

Microservices is an architectural style that structures an application as a collection of small, autonomous services modeled around a business domain. Each service is self-contained and should implement a single business capability.

Best Practices for Performance

1. Decompose by Business Capability

When breaking down your application into microservices, it is crucial to decompose it by business capability. This method ensures that each service is focused and can be developed, deployed, and scaled independently.

2. Data Management

Efficient data management is key to microservices performance. Use a decentralized approach where each service manages its own database. This practice reduces dependencies and improves performance.

3. API Gateway

An API Gateway can help manage and route requests to the appropriate microservice. It can also provide functionalities like load balancing, caching, and security, which are essential for maintaining performance.

4. Asynchronous Communication

Where possible, use asynchronous communication between services. This can be achieved through message queues or event streams, which helps in maintaining responsiveness and performance.

5. Monitoring and Logging

Implement robust monitoring and logging mechanisms to track the performance of each microservice. Tools like Prometheus, Grafana, and ELK stack can be invaluable for performance monitoring and troubleshooting.

6. Containerization

Use containerization tools like Docker and orchestration platforms like Kubernetes to efficiently manage microservices. Containers provide consistency across environments and help in scaling services up or down based on demand.

Conclusion

By adhering to these best practices, you can significantly enhance the performance of your microservices architecture. At Resolute IT Consulting, we specialize in helping businesses implement and optimize their microservices architecture to meet their unique needs.

Stay tuned for more insights and tips on microservices and other architectural best practices!

🚀 #Microservices #Architecture #BestPractices #Performance #SoftwareDevelopment #ResoluteITConsulting #TechTips

Enhancing Performance with Microservices: Best Practices Read More »

Mastering Rule Management in Modern Software Solutions

Mastering Rule Management in Modern Software Solutions

Mastering Rule Management in Modern Software Solutions

At Resolute IT Consulting, we understand that effective rule management is crucial for developing robust and scalable software solutions. Rule management involves defining, deploying, monitoring, and maintaining the various business rules that govern your software applications. In this post, we will explore the best practices for rule management and how it can enhance your software’s performance and reliability.

What is Rule Management?

Rule management is the process of creating, deploying, and managing business rules within your software systems. These rules dictate the behavior of your applications and ensure that they adhere to the necessary business logic and regulations. Proper rule management helps in maintaining consistency, reducing errors, and ensuring compliance with industry standards.

Best Practices for Rule Management

  • Centralized Rule Repository: Maintain a centralized repository for all your business rules. This helps in easy access, updates, and ensures consistency across different modules of your application.
  • Version Control: Implement version control for your rules to keep track of changes and ensure that you can revert to previous versions if necessary.
  • Automated Testing: Regularly test your rules using automated testing frameworks to ensure they work as expected and do not introduce any regressions.
  • Monitoring and Analytics: Use monitoring tools to track the performance and effectiveness of your rules. Analytics can help you understand the impact of different rules and optimize them for better performance.
  • Documentation: Maintain comprehensive documentation for all your rules. This helps in better understanding and easier maintenance by different team members.

Benefits of Effective Rule Management

Implementing an effective rule management system can bring several benefits to your software solutions:

  • Consistency: Ensures that all parts of your application adhere to the same business logic.
  • Flexibility: Allows for easy updates and modifications to business rules without requiring major changes to the codebase.
  • Compliance: Helps in maintaining compliance with industry regulations and standards.
  • Efficiency: Reduces the likelihood of errors and improves the overall performance of your software.
  • Transparency: Provides clear visibility into the business logic and rules governing your applications.

At Resolute IT Consulting, we specialize in providing top-notch rule management solutions tailored to your business needs. Our team of experts ensures that your software applications are efficient, reliable, and compliant with industry standards.

Stay tuned for more insights on #RuleManagement, #SoftwareSolutions, and #BestPractices from Resolute IT Consulting. Together, we can build software that performs exceptionally and stands the test of time.

🔧💼 #RuleManagement #SoftwareDevelopment #BestPractices #Performance #ResoluteITConsulting

Mastering Rule Management in Modern Software Solutions Read More »

Enhancing Financial Security with Advanced Rule Management Systems

Enhancing Financial Security with Advanced Rule Management Systems

Introduction

In the rapidly evolving financial landscape, rule management systems have become pivotal for ensuring compliance and enhancing security. At Resolute IT Consulting, we believe that robust rule management is the cornerstone of effective financial operations. In this post, we explore how advanced rule management systems can fortify your financial security.

Why Rule Management Matters

Rule management systems are essential for defining, monitoring, and enforcing the rules that govern financial transactions. These systems help in identifying suspicious activities, ensuring compliance with regulatory standards, and mitigating risks associated with financial crimes.

Key Features of Advanced Rule Management Systems

  • Automated Monitoring: Continuous monitoring of transactions to detect anomalies in real-time.
  • Compliance Management: Ensuring that all transactions adhere to local and international regulations.
  • Risk Assessment: Evaluating the risk associated with each transaction to prevent fraud.
  • Customizable Rules: Tailoring rules to meet the specific needs of your organization.

Benefits of Implementing Rule Management Systems

Implementing a robust rule management system can offer numerous benefits, including:

  • Enhanced Security: Proactively identifying and mitigating potential security threats.
  • Regulatory Compliance: Ensuring that your organization meets all regulatory requirements.
  • Operational Efficiency: Automating routine tasks to reduce manual effort and errors.
  • Transparency: Providing clear visibility into financial operations and decision-making processes.

Conclusion

Incorporating advanced rule management systems into your financial operations can significantly enhance security and compliance. At Resolute IT Consulting, we specialize in developing and implementing customized rule management solutions to meet your specific needs. Partner with us to secure your financial future.

🔒💼 #RuleManagement #FinancialSecurity #Compliance #RiskManagement #ResoluteITConsulting

Enhancing Financial Security with Advanced Rule Management Systems Read More »